🏘️ Neighborhood

The neighborhood of Glenville lies between six and eight miles from downtown Cleveland. A short trip on I-90 takes commuters from their houses with porches on quiet, leafy streets to the city's center. For rest and relaxation, head to the Cleveland Lakefront Nature Preserve right on Lake Erie with its winding, easy-to-walk trails, bird meadows, and wildflowers. While in the park, take in the views at the scenic Doan Brook Outflow and the Intercity Yacht Club. Locals also delight in Gordon Park, with its wild landscape in the middle of a big city. Don’t leave out the nearby Russian Cultural Garden, the Cleveland Cultural Gardens, and the Rockefeller Park Greenhouse. For those into pop culture, fans of the Superman character flock to the boyhood home of its creator, Jerry Siegel. Learn more about living in Glenville

🛡️ Renters Insurance — Estimated Cost

Estimated range for Ohio at $20,000 – $24,999 of personal property

$13–$16/ monthEstimate — not a quote

About $165–$184 a year.

Based on what Ohio renters actually paid: NAIC industry data for 2023 (average HO-4 premium, 756,038 policy-years), adjusted to July 2026 with the U.S. Bureau of Labor Statistics tenants' insurance index. It is a market average, not a price for this building and not a price for you.

Your own price depends most on your credit-based insurance score, your claims history and which carrier you choose. In published Ohio figures the same coverage ranges from $127 a year at excellent credit to $933 at poor credit. We do not ask for any of that, so we cannot narrow this for you.
